Dysbiosis, or gut flora imbalance, is a common digestive condition in rabbits characterized by disruption of the normal microbial populations in the cecum and intestinal tract. Rabbits possess a highly specialized hindgut fermentation digestive system that relies on billions of beneficial bacteria, protozoa, and fungi working in careful balance to ferment fiber and produce essential nutrients. When this microbial ecosystem becomes disrupted, the rabbit experiences a range of digestive symptoms that can significantly affect health and quality of life. Dysbiosis is particularly significant in rabbits because their cecal fermentation is not just helpful but essential for their survival and nutrition.
The most common manifestation of dysbiosis that owners observe is the production of soft, malformed, or unusually smelly cecotropes that the rabbit does not consume normally. Healthy cecotropes, also called night feces, are soft, grape-like clusters that rabbits typically eat directly from the anus to obtain essential vitamins and nutrients produced by cecal bacteria. When dysbiosis occurs, cecotropes may become unusually soft, mushy, or liquid, and may have a particularly strong, unpleasant odor. The rabbit often fails to consume these abnormal cecotropes, leaving them to accumulate in the cage or stick to the rabbit's fur. This condition is sometimes called intermittent soft cecotropes or cecal dysbiosis.
Dysbiosis can range from mild, chronic production of soft cecotropes to severe bacterial overgrowth that produces true diarrhea and life-threatening illness. In mild cases, the rabbit may appear otherwise healthy but consistently produce abnormal cecotropes. In more severe cases, the bacterial imbalance can lead to overgrowth of harmful organisms, production of toxins, intestinal inflammation, and systemic illness. Dysbiosis also predisposes to GI stasis by disrupting normal fermentation patterns and causing discomfort that reduces appetite. The interconnected nature of rabbit digestive health means that dysbiosis rarely exists as an isolated problem.
The good news is that mild to moderate dysbiosis often responds well to dietary correction and supportive management. Identifying and removing the underlying cause, typically dietary problems, allows the gut flora to gradually reestablish normal balance. However, severe dysbiosis requires veterinary attention, and all rabbits with digestive symptoms should be evaluated by a rabbit-savvy veterinarian to ensure accurate diagnosis and appropriate treatment. Prevention through proper diet emphasizing unlimited hay is far more effective than treating established dysbiosis.
